New Israeli massacre in Deir al-Balah on 171st day of genocide

IOF continue to target the vicinity of al-Shifa Medical Complex with artillery and aerial bombardment amid intense gunfire from military vehicles.

The Israeli occupation continues its relentless and genocidal campaign against Gaza for the 171st consecutive day, targeting different regions of the Strip and enforcing a complete blockade. This has further worsened the already dire humanitarian situation, exacerbating the suffering of the people in Gaza.

The Israeli bombardment of the Salman family's residence in Deir al-Balah resulted in the killing of 22 people. Additionally, IOF conducted an airstrike on the al-Nuseirat refugee camp in the central Gaza Strip. 

Three people were killed and several injuries were reported, with casualties transferred to al-Kuwait Hospital, after Israeli warplanes bombed the Barhoum family's residence near Salah al-Din Mosque in the densely populated al-Zaytoun neighborhood, where many forcibly displaced Palestinians reside.

Meanwhile, the Civil Defense in Gaza confirmed its inability to respond to distress calls received from Palestinians subjected to Israeli shelling in the al-Shati refugee camp west of Gaza City.

The Civil Defense urged the United Nations Secretary-General to "urgently intervene to provide the needs of civil defense to protect civilians."

War on hospitals is ongoing

IOF continue to target the vicinity of al-Shifa Medical Complex with artillery and aerial bombardment, amid intense gunfire from military vehicles. Similarly, IOF targeted the vicinity of al-Amal Hospital and the eastern areas of Khan Younis city in the southern Gaza Strip.

The Palestine Red Crescent Society (PRCS), on Sunday, reported it lost communication with its personnel stationed at al-Amal Hospital in the Gaza city of Khan Younis, attributing the matter to ongoing aggression by the Israel Occupation Forces (IOF).

The various means of communication, including landlines, cellular networks, and internet services, have remained severed in Khan Younis governorate for 72 consecutive days, as per PRCS.

In the latest updates regarding al-Amal Hospital, the association reported that all displaced individuals and patients capable of movement were evacuated towards the al-Mawasi area west of Khan Younis City. However, the association's teams, along with nine patients and their ten accompanying individuals, as well as a forcibly displaced family with children requiring special care, remained at the hospital.

The PRCS pleaded for the evacuation of the patients and the wounded, as well as the bodies of two martyrs: Amir Abu Aisha, an emergency-room staff member at the Palestinian Red Crescent, who was shot and killed by Israeli troops at al-Amal Hospital, and a wounded individual being treated at the hospital, who tragically passed away today due to a head injury.

The International Committee of the Red Cross has repeatedly expressed grave concern about reports of ongoing military operations inside hospital premises and its surroundings.
